History of Spain. Madrid. The official inauguration of the "Cárcel Modelo" on 20 December 1883 led to the transfer of all the inmates of the The Saladero Prison (Cárcel del Saladero, also known as Cárcel de Villa). The former "Saladero" (from its original use for bacon salting), used as a correctional prison in unhealthy conditions, was converted into a men's prison by virtue of a decree issued in mid-1831 by King Ferdinand VII. Transfer of the prisoners from the Saladero Prison to the new Cárcel Modelo: first group, in the early hours of 9 May 1884. It was carried out in groups of 30, tied with ropes or chains, depending on the seriousness of the crime of which they were convicted, walking slowly between couples of the Public Security corps. Drawing from life by Nao. Engraving by Bernardo Rico (1825-1894). La Ilustración Española y Americana (The Spanish and American Illustration), May 22, 1884. Author: Manuel Nao (1843-1884).
